首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

获取自定义搜索的cx ID,Google API - Python

获取自定义搜索的cx ID,Google API - Python

要获取自定义搜索的cx ID,可以使用Google API。首先,您需要注册一个Google Cloud Platform (GCP)项目,并创建一个服务账户。然后,您需要安装Google Cloud SDK并使用gcloud命令行工具,通过以下命令来创建服务账户并获取凭据:

代码语言:txt
复制
gcloud auth login

接下来,您需要使用以下命令来创建自定义搜索的cx ID:

代码语言:txt
复制
gcloud customsearch indexes create "https://www.googleapis.com/customsearch/v1?key=<YOUR_API_KEY>" --cx-id=<YOUR_SEARCH_ENGINE_ID> --project=<YOUR_PROJECT_ID>

其中<YOUR_API_KEY><YOUR_PROJECT_ID>是您服务账户的凭据,<YOUR_SEARCH_ENGINE_ID>是您要使用的自定义搜索的cx ID。

接下来,您需要使用以下命令来创建自定义搜索的索引:

代码语言:txt
复制
gcloud customsearch indexes create "https://www.googleapis.com/customsearch/v1?key=<YOUR_API_KEY>" --cx-id=<YOUR_SEARCH_ENGINE_ID> --project=<YOUR_PROJECT_ID>

其中<YOUR_API_KEY><YOUR_PROJECT_ID>是您服务账户的凭据,<YOUR_SEARCH_ENGINE_ID>是您要使用的自定义搜索的cx ID。

最后,您需要使用以下命令来获取自定义搜索的cx ID:

代码语言:txt
复制
gcloud customsearch indexes search --cx-id=<YOUR_SEARCH_ENGINE_ID> --project=<YOUR_PROJECT_ID>

其中<YOUR_SEARCH_ENGINE_ID>是您要使用的自定义搜索的cx ID,<YOUR_PROJECT_ID>是您要使用的项目的ID。

这样,您就可以使用Google API来获取自定义搜索的cx ID了。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

使用 Python-Twitter 搜索 API 获取最新推文 ID

问题背景在使用 Twitter 搜索 API 获取推文时,我们可能会遇到重复获取相同推文问题。这可能会导致我们在处理推文时出现数据丢失或重复情况。...为了解决这个问题,我们需要找到一种方法来避免获取重复推文。2. 解决方案一种解决方法是使用 Twitter 搜索 API since_id 参数。...since_id 参数可以让我们指定一个推文 ID,并仅获取该推文 ID 之后发布推文。通过这种方式,我们可以避免获取重复推文。...下面是一个使用 since_id 参数获取最新推文 ID Python 代码示例:import twitterclass Test(): def __init__(self):...通过这种方式,我们可以避免获取重复推文。另外,我们还可以使用 max_id 参数来指定一个推文 ID,并仅获取该推文 ID 之前推文。这也可以用来避免获取重复推文。

11800

Google自定义搜索引擎

另外,分析了自定义搜索引擎请求数据url,模拟请求并获取搜索结果。...在网上搜索了一些资料,捣鼓了google自定义搜索引擎功能,发现确实挺好玩。后面又有同仁问能不能介绍一下如何实现使用google搜索api,那么下面就开始吧。...=搜索引擎ID&q=数学&sort=&googlehost=www.google.com url主要参数分析: cx搜索引擎ID q:搜索关键 sort:搜索结果排序方式 构造上面这种模式url,采用...明白了引擎请求搜索结果这一流程,那么用c#语言来实现就非常简单了。代码非常简单,就不贴出来。 4 总结 使用googleapi自定义搜索引擎最最关键一点就是,你机器要能够访问google。...要是不能访问google,那就只能/(ㄒoㄒ)/~~。本文举例子是搜索百度网盘资源,当然你也可以搜索博客园所有资源。 其实,google自定义搜索引擎api还有更加精彩设置,你可以去玩玩。

1.1K20
  • 谷歌api_谷歌浏览器添加搜索引擎

    大家好,又见面了,我是你们朋友全栈君。 1. 搜索引擎API 接口地址为 https://www.proxy.ustclug.org/customsearch/v1?...key={YOUR_KEY}&q={SEARCH_WORDS}&cx={YOUR_CX}&start={10}&num={10} 通过谷歌可编程搜索引擎自定义个人搜索引擎,并且记住搜索引擎 CX id...创建后即可根据项目中api id,查询链接 console.cloud.google.com 根据CX idapi id,即可调用定义好搜索引擎api。 2....效果 访问网址 google.pazhufeng.com 效果: 搜书: 参考: 如何使用谷歌搜索API获取结果 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。...如发现本站有涉嫌侵权/违法违规内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

    1.3K30

    无缝整合 Google 自定义搜索框到 WordPress

    第一步:注册并获取 Google 自定义搜索代码 整合 Google 自定义搜索之前肯定必须要先让 Google 为你服务,通过访问 http://www.google.com/cse/ 创建你搜索引擎...创建完毕后进入“外观”面板,选择“全宽”布局模式。保存后进入“获取代码”,获得你 Google 自定义搜索代码: <!...('你Google自定义搜索ID'); customSearchControl.setResultSetSize(google.search.Search.FILTERED_CSE_RESULTSET...> 其中将“你 Google 自定义搜索 ID”替换为 Google 给你搜索引擎唯一 ID”,可以在控制面板基本信息内获取。 保存后将 search.php 上传至你主题根目录下。...这一步我们要做是:从 URL 中提取浏览者搜索关键词,然后调用 Google API 进行搜索。听起来很复杂?

    33320

    Google搜索解析规则-更准确使用谷歌搜索引擎获取到自己想要内容

    而对于技术类问题检索,谷歌表现水准无疑要甩百度几条街;所以善用搜索引擎第一条原则必然是:一如既往毫不犹豫百折不挠使用Google。...而对于一名程序员来说,保证自己随时随地能访问Google,是最最基本技能,哪怕花费少许金钱也是物超所值。那么以下就撇开百度、专门讲讲使用Google小贴士。...完整匹配 在Google输入框里,所有的空格都被理解为加号。...通配符 另外一个程序员耳熟能详符号是正则里最常露脸星号,看到星号就下意识想到通配符,在Google搜索规则中也是如此,输入”mysql connect error *”就会返回所有已知关于MySQL...语言和日期 像2shou叔这种英语阅读能力不过关的人,遇到急事就不能一篇篇翻原版文档了,不得不求助国内二手货;这时,Google界面上一个小按钮就帮上大忙了:点击搜索工具 – 不限语言,下拉选择所有简体中文网页

    73450

    Python使用免费天气API,获取全球任意地区天气情况

    选型API: 天气API中有大把免费api,如:国内心知天气,国际雅虎,还有今天主角:wunderground 最终选择了wunderground,原因:1,需求是全球任意地区(国内API请求国外地区需要收费才能访问...), 2.wunderground提供是信息最全,最丰富天气api.雅虎提供天气API信息非常之简略....直入主题: 官方API文档 这里免费api只是说测试账号每天有500次免费请求,要是公司需求大的话,那么就需要付费了.官网价格 准备工作,你需要在官网注册一个账号,然后随意打开一个API文档, 你会见到.... python代码: #!...然后在方法 get_forecast_10day(),get_history(), get_history_10day()封装了一下,原因是官网不同api获取天气信息所叫名称不一样(变量名) 这样用起来有点麻烦

    3K20

    软件测试人工智能|一文教你如何配置自己AutoGPT

    申请密钥申请OpenAI密钥 获取OpenAI API 密钥: https://platform.openai.com/account/api-keys配置谷歌APIhttps://console.cloud.google.com...此部分是可选,如果我们在运行谷歌搜索时遇到错误 429 问题,那我们就需要使用官方谷歌 api。要使用该命令,需要在环境变量中设置 Google API 密钥。...转到 API 和服务仪表板,然后单击“启用 API 和服务”。搜索自定义搜索API”并单击它,然后单击“启用”转到凭据页面,然后单击“创建凭据”。...选择“API 密钥”复制 API 密钥并将其设置为计算机上命名环境变量。在项目上启用自定义搜索 API。转到自定义搜索引擎页面,然后单击“添加”。按照提示设置搜索引擎。...创建搜索引擎后,单击“控制面板”,然后单击“基本信息”。复制“搜索引擎 ID”并将其设置为计算机上命名环境变量。

    32410

    C#开发BIMFACE系列16 服务端API获取模型数据1:查询满足条件构件ID列表

    系列目录 【已更新最新开发文章,点击查看详细】 源文件/模型转换完成之后,可以获取模型具体数据。本篇介绍根据文件ID查询满足条件构件ID列表。...请求地址:GET https://api.bimface.com/data/v2/files/{fileId}/elementIds 说明:根据六个维度(专业,系统类型,楼层,构件类型,族,族类型)获取对应构件...ID列表,任何维度都是可选。...构件ID分页查询相关请参考这里 同时,也支持根据空间关系从房间计算出房间内构件ID列表 构件与房间空间关系计算相关请参考这里 参数: ? ?...查询满足条件构件ID列表 ,只对三维模型适用。二维图纸没有目录树。

    88410

    使用Python操作MySQL和Oracle数据库

    Python连接数据库之前,得先准备好MySQL数据库,由于篇幅问题这里不再说明软件下载和安装过程,请自行Google,只简单介绍环境配置,MySQL采用5.7.17GPL版本,数据库是本地数据库,端口为默认...\Python36\lib\site-packages\sqlalchemy\ext\declarative\api.py", line 65, in __init__ _as_declarative...对SQLAlchemy框架不熟悉建议还是使用标准API接口来连接数据库比较好,那么下面就继续说说使用python来操作Oracle数据库。 ?...下面通过Python连接,需要借助第三方cx_Oracle包,使用pip3 install cx_Oracle即可。...写在最后 Python使用标准API接口操作数据库是很简单,主要有六大步:连接数据库、打开游标、执行SQL、提交、关闭游标、关闭数据库。

    2.8K10

    解决cx_Freeze打包出错importError:can not import name idnadata

    ,它使用了​​requests​​库来从OpenWeatherMap API获取天气数据。​​...然后,通过运行以下命令来运行cx_Freeze进行打包:plaintextCopy codepython setup.py build打包完成后,会生成一个可执行文件,你可以在命令行中运行该文件,并输入城市来获取天气信息...自定义配置:你可以使用cx_Freeze配置文件来自定义打包过程,包括指定要包含文件、目录、图标等。...结论cx_Freeze是一个功能强大Python打包工具,它可以将Python代码和依赖库一同打包成可执行文件,方便程序发布和部署。...通过学习和使用cx_Freeze,你可以快速打包你Python应用程序,并在没有Python环境机器上独立运行。

    45630

    基于Qt网络音乐播放器(四)酷狗API接口获取歌曲搜索列表和歌曲播放

    2.准备好前面获取酷狗api接口 第一个是搜索接口: http://mobilecdn.kugou.com/api/v3/search/song?...format=json&keyword=你需要填&page=你需要填&pagesize=你需要填 keyword:搜索内容。...page:搜索页数 pagesize:返回数据量,填10就是返回1首歌曲数据。...第一目标个是通过该接口,实现歌曲搜索,第二个目标是通过该接口获取特定歌曲hash和album_id值用于下面歌曲播放,文字图片以及歌词(下一篇讲)显示 第二个是歌曲详细接口: http://...r=play/getdata""&hash=你需要填&album_id=你需要填&_=1497972864535 hash和album_id都是第一个接口返回json解析出来

    2.9K63

    手把手教你搭建一个Python连接数据库快速取数工具

    sql脚本,快速完成数据获取---授人以渔方式,提供平台或工具。...4)、使用多线程提取数据 一、数据库连接类 cx_Oracle是一个Python 扩展模块,相当于pythonOracle数据库驱动,通过使用所有数据库访问模块通用数据库 API来实现Oracle...本文主要介绍一下Pandas中read_sql_query方法使用。 1:pd.read_sql_query() 读取自定义数据,返还DataFrame格式,通过SQL查询脚本包括增删改查。...是一个Python 扩展模块,相当于pythonOracle数据库驱动,通过使用所有数据库访问模块通用数据库 API来实现Oracle 数据库查询和更新。...= b_build_info.set_index("BUILDCODE")["ID"].to_dict() return ID_bUILDCODE #通过文本传入待导出数据清单 def

    1.1K10
    领券